David Scanlan
David Scanlan (Republican Party) is the New Hampshire Secretary of State. He assumed office on January 10, 2022. His current term ends on December 4, 2026.
Scanlan previously served as the deputy secretary of state of New Hampshire and was sworn in after William Gardner (D) retired in January 2022 in accordance with Article 69 of the New Hampshire Constitution.[1] The New Hampshire Legislature re-elected Scanlan on December 7, 2022.[2]
Biography
Scanlan received a bachelor's degree from West Virginia University in 1978. Scanlan previously worked as the deputy secretary of state for New Hampshire.[3]
